Modified Ross procedure to prevent autograft dilatation
Ross M Ungerleider1, Yoshio Ootaki, Irving Shen
1Department of Pediatric Cardiothoracic Surgery, Rainbow Babies and Children's Hospital, University Hospitals Case Medical Center, Cleveland, Ohio, USA. rmungerl@wfubmc.edu
The Annals of Thoracic Surgery
|August 25, 2010
Summary
A modified Ross procedure using a Dacron graft to encase the autograft prevents autograft dilatation, a common complication. This technique shows promising results for adults at risk of this long-term issue.

Background:
- Autograft dilatation is a significant long-term complication following the Ross procedure.
- This complication can manifest within 1-2 years post-operation, impacting patient outcomes.
Purpose of the Study:
- To describe a modified Ross procedure designed to prevent autograft dilatation.
- To evaluate the efficacy and reproducibility of this novel surgical technique.
Main Methods:
- A modified Ross procedure was developed, involving complete encasement of the autograft within a Dacron graft (Hemashield) before implantation.
- The technique was performed on 30 patients since October 2004.
Main Results:
- No mortality was observed in the 30 patients who underwent the modified procedure.
- Follow-up assessments revealed no instances of autograft dilatation among the patients.
Conclusions:
- The modified Ross procedure, utilizing a Dacron graft to reinforce the autograft, effectively prevents autograft dilatation.
- This technique is reproducible and particularly suitable for adult patients susceptible to autograft dilatation after the Ross procedure.
